Ras Kaya Paul of Pacific NW Roots (Washington)

from The Hashish Inn · host The Hashish Inn

In this interview we get to sit down with Kaya of Pacific NW Roots based in Washington.   We discuss the difficulties of operating under the strenuous regulations found in the Washington recreational cannabis market & finding a way to not only survive, but also thrive by cultivating and processing your own material - to add value to your crop.  We talk about some of Kaya's breeding project - such as the Koffee and it's lineage, as well as older lineages such as the Afghani Hashplant, the Pez coming down from Canada in the mid 1990's.  We also talk about regenerative farming, the importance of community, Hawaii and much more!
